## Tuning

The `vault-churn` utility rotates service credentials for Pellam Systems' internal stores on a rolling schedule. Defaults are conservative: rotation batches are small and retries back off aggressively to avoid lockouts during upstream flakiness. Before changing anything, read the rollback section — stale grace windows are the usual source of outages. The tunable constants live below.

constants for tageg-kagag:
QUOTAS = {
    "kelax": 495,
    "istath": 366,
    "tammir": 108,
    "novdor": 730,
    "casax": 816,
    "quenael": 874,
    "pelius": 403,
}

Hi, and welcome to the TranscodeBarn on-call rotation. The farm processes uploads for the Vexley player, and the most common page is a stuck job queue when a worker node wedges mid-transcode. Standard response: drain the node, requeue its jobs, and confirm throughput recovers within ten minutes. Don't restart the scheduler unless the queue depth keeps climbing afterward — that causes duplicate renders. The full escalation path and node inventory live on this page:

runbook for badug-kadup: https://confluence.zemvarlabs.internal/projects/browse/display/projects/bd1b

Fleet fuel report (Oxwagon): runs nightly, pulls pump logs from the depot collector, joins against vehicle assignments, and drops a CSV in the finance bucket. Heads up for review: the join uses driver badge numbers, so treat the output as restricted. Retention is 90 days. Access controls and the data-flow diagram are documented here.

runbook for kajof-bahif: https://sentry.ferranet.local/merge_requests/repo/projects/view/81769af030f7d6d2

## SQL Linting at Quarrelstone

All SQL files in the Ledgerline repo run through our linter, sqlgate, before merge. Reviewers should reject PRs with uppercase keywords disabled, missing trailing semicolons, or implicit joins. Rule config lives in .sqlgate.toml at repo root; do not override per-file. If the linter flags a false positive, add a justification comment rather than suppressing silently. To unlock the lint-rule admin panel in the review console, you'll need the recovery passphrase below.

vault phrase of tawig-taduf = zorath-oliwyn